I just notice that this feature did not exist. Such a feature would definitely improve my firefox experience. For example, if I were able to add file type I could change the folder which these files download to, rather than having them download to my default folder and have to move them to the correct folder. Additionally, I could choose a different action for other file types to increase efficiency. It is at most a minor inconvenience, however I think you can agree that even minor details matter.
